Robert James served 13 years in the RAF Fire and Rescue Service and two years with the Saudi Arabian Ministry of Defence and Civil Aviation as an operational Chief Fire Officer and instructor. He has also worked in the NHS as a Fire Safety Adviser, and in private sector healthcare for over 40 years.
